Exposed Ceilings: Embrace the Raw

One of the most popular and budget-friendly basement ceiling ideas is to leave the ceiling unfinished, exposing the raw structure. This industrial-chic look not only adds character to your space but also saves you the cost of drywall or other finishing materials.

To pull off this look, ensure your ceiling is structurally sound and free of any hazards. You can then clean up the space by removing any webs, dust, or debris. For a polished touch, consider painting the ceiling a light color to reflect more light and brighten up the room.

Beams and Joists: Highlight the Bones of Your Space

If your basement ceiling has exposed beams or joists, consider highlighting them rather than hiding them behind drywall. This architectural feature can add visual interest and warmth to your space, creating a cozy, cabin-like atmosphere.

To emphasize the beams, you can stain them a darker color for contrast or paint them to match the ceiling for a more subtle look. If the beams are in poor condition, you can wrap them in wood or PVC to give them a fresh, uniform appearance.

Drop Ceilings: Create a False Ceiling on a Budget

If you're looking for a way to hide unsightly pipes, wires, or an uneven ceiling, a drop ceiling might be the perfect solution. Also known as a suspended ceiling, this system involves hanging a new ceiling below the existing one, creating a smooth, finished look.

Drop ceilings are typically made from lightweight, affordable materials like mineral fiber or metal panels. They're easy to install and maintain, and they can even help improve acoustics in your basement. To keep costs low, choose a simple, uniform tile pattern and avoid incorporating expensive lighting features.

Recessed Lighting: A Sleek, Modern Touch

Recessed lighting can add a sleek, modern touch to your basement ceiling while providing ample light. These fixtures are installed directly into the ceiling, creating a flush, seamless look that's perfect for both contemporary and traditional styles.

To keep costs down, opt for LED bulbs, which are energy-efficient and long-lasting. You can also install the fixtures yourself, saving on labor costs. Just be sure to follow safety guidelines and consult with a professional if you're unsure about any aspect of the installation.

Pendent and Chandelier Lighting: Add Style and Ambience

For a more dramatic effect, consider adding pendant or chandelier lighting to your basement ceiling. These fixtures can add visual interest, create a focal point, and provide warm, ambient light.

To find affordable options, look for fixtures made from materials like glass, metal, or resin, and choose designs that are simple and understated. You can also DIY your own pendant lights using materials like mason jars, wooden crates, or even old lighting fixtures you've repurposed.
